diff --git a/MAINTAINERS b/MAINTAINERS index f25ca7cd00..3356c65dd0 100644 --- a/MAINTAINERS +++ b/MAINTAINERS @@ -481,6 +481,7 @@ F: drivers/power/regulator/stpmic1.c F: drivers/ram/stm32mp1/ F: drivers/remoteproc/stm32_copro.c F: drivers/reset/stm32-reset.c +F: drivers/rng/optee_rng.c F: drivers/rng/stm32mp1_rng.c F: drivers/rtc/stm32_rtc.c F: drivers/serial/serial_stm32.* diff --git a/drivers/rng/Kconfig b/drivers/rng/Kconfig index b1c5ab93d1..a02c585f61 100644 --- a/drivers/rng/Kconfig +++ b/drivers/rng/Kconfig @@ -31,6 +31,14 @@ config RNG_MSM This driver provides support for the Random Number Generator hardware found on Qualcomm SoCs. +config RNG_OPTEE + bool "OP-TEE based Random Number Generator support" + depends on DM_RNG && OPTEE + help + This driver provides support for OP-TEE based Random Number + Generator on ARM SoCs where hardware entropy sources are not + accessible to normal world. + config RNG_STM32MP1 bool "Enable random number generator for STM32MP1" depends on ARCH_STM32MP diff --git a/drivers/rng/Makefile b/drivers/rng/Makefile index 39f7ee3f03..435b3b965a 100644 --- a/drivers/rng/Makefile +++ b/drivers/rng/Makefile @@ -7,6 +7,7 @@ obj-$(CONFIG_DM_RNG) += rng-uclass.o obj-$(CONFIG_RNG_MESON) += meson-rng.o obj-$(CONFIG_RNG_SANDBOX) += sandbox_rng.o obj-$(CONFIG_RNG_MSM) += msm_rng.o +obj-$(CONFIG_RNG_OPTEE) += optee_rng.o obj-$(CONFIG_RNG_STM32MP1) += stm32mp1_rng.o obj-$(CONFIG_RNG_ROCKCHIP) += rockchip_rng.o obj-$(CONFIG_RNG_IPROC200) += iproc_rng200.o diff --git a/drivers/rng/optee_rng.c b/drivers/rng/optee_rng.c new file mode 100644 index 0000000000..a0833d0862 --- /dev/null +++ b/drivers/rng/optee_rng.c @@ -0,0 +1,156 @@ +//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0+ OR BSD-3-Clause +/* + * Copyright (C) 2022, STMicroelectronics - All Rights Reserved + */ +#define LOG_CATEGORY UCLASS_RNG + +#include <common.h> + +#include <rng.h> +#include <tee.h> +#include <dm/device.h> +#include <dm/device_compat.h> +#include <linux/sizes.h> + +#define TEE_ERROR_HEALTH_TEST_FAIL 0x00000001 + +/* + * TA_CMD_GET_ENTROPY - Get Entropy from RNG + * + * param[0] (inout memref) - Entropy buffer memory reference + * param[1] unused + * param[2] unused + * param[3] unused + * + * Result: + * TEE_SUCCESS - Invoke command success + * TEE_ERROR_BAD_PARAMETERS - Incorrect input param + * TEE_ERROR_NOT_SUPPORTED - Requested entropy size greater than size of pool + * TEE_ERROR_HEALTH_TEST_FAIL - Continuous health testing failed + */ +#define TA_CMD_GET_ENTROPY 0x0 + +#define MAX_ENTROPY_REQ_SZ SZ_4K + +#define TA_HWRNG_UUID { 0xab7a617c, 0xb8e7, 0x4d8f, \ + { 0x83, 0x01, 0xd0, 0x9b, 0x61, 0x03, 0x6b, 0x64 } } + +/** + * struct optee_rng_priv - OP-TEE Random Number Generator private data + * @session_id: RNG TA session identifier. + */ +struct optee_rng_priv { + u32 session_id; +}; + +static int get_optee_rng_data(struct udevice *dev, + struct tee_shm *entropy_shm_pool, + void *buf, size_t *size) +{ + struct optee_rng_priv *priv = dev_get_priv(dev); + int ret = 0; + struct tee_invoke_arg arg; + struct tee_param param; + + memset(&arg, 0, sizeof(arg)); + memset(¶m, 0, sizeof(param)); + + /* Invoke TA_CMD_GET_ENTROPY function of Trusted App */ + arg.func = TA_CMD_GET_ENTROPY; + arg.session = priv->session_id; + + /* Fill invoke cmd params */ + param.attr = TEE_PARAM_ATTR_TYPE_MEMREF_INOUT; + param.u.memref.shm = entropy_shm_pool; + param.u.memref.size = *size; + + ret = tee_invoke_func(dev->parent, &arg, 1, ¶m); + if (ret || arg.ret) { + if (!ret) + ret = -EPROTO; + dev_err(dev, "TA_CMD_GET_ENTROPY invoke err: %d 0x%x\n", ret, arg.ret); + *size = 0; + + return ret; + } + + memcpy(buf, param.u.memref.shm->addr, param.u.memref.size); + *size = param.u.memref.size; + + return 0; +} + +static int optee_rng_read(struct udevice *dev, void *buf, size_t len) +{ + size_t read = 0, rng_size = 0; + struct tee_shm *entropy_shm_pool; + u8 *data = buf; + int ret; + + ret = tee_shm_alloc(dev->parent, MAX_ENTROPY_REQ_SZ, 0, &entropy_shm_pool); + if (ret) { + dev_err(dev, "tee_shm_alloc failed: %d\n", ret); + return ret; + } + + while (read < len) { + rng_size = min(len - read, (size_t)MAX_ENTROPY_REQ_SZ); + ret = get_optee_rng_data(dev, entropy_shm_pool, data, &rng_size); + if (ret) + goto shm_free; + data += rng_size; + read += rng_size; + } + +shm_free: + tee_shm_free(entropy_shm_pool); + + return ret; +} + +static int optee_rng_probe(struct udevice *dev) +{ + const struct tee_optee_ta_uuid uuid = TA_HWRNG_UUID; + struct optee_rng_priv *priv = dev_get_priv(dev); + struct tee_open_session_arg sess_arg; + int ret; + + memset(&sess_arg, 0, sizeof(sess_arg)); + + /* Open session with hwrng Trusted App */ + tee_optee_ta_uuid_to_octets(sess_arg.uuid, &uuid); + sess_arg.clnt_login = TEE_LOGIN_PUBLIC; + + ret = tee_open_session(dev->parent, &sess_arg, 0, NULL); + if (ret || sess_arg.ret) { + if (!ret) + ret = -EIO; + dev_err(dev, "can't open session: %d 0x%x\n", ret, sess_arg.ret); + return ret; + } + priv->session_id = sess_arg.session; + + return 0; +} + +static int optee_rng_remove(struct udevice *dev) +{ + struct optee_rng_priv *priv = dev_get_priv(dev); + + tee_close_session(dev->parent, priv->session_id); + + return 0; +} + +static const struct dm_rng_ops optee_rng_ops = { + .read = optee_rng_read, +}; + +U_BOOT_DRIVER(optee_rng) = { + .name = "optee-rng", + .id = UCLASS_RNG, + .ops = &optee_rng_ops, + .probe = optee_rng_probe, + .remove = optee_rng_remove, + .priv_auto = sizeof(struct optee_rng_priv), +};
Add driver for OP-TEE based Random Number Generator on ARM SoCs where hardware entropy sources are not accessible to normal world and the RNG service is provided by a HWRNG Trusted Application (TA). This driver is based on the linux driver: char/hw_random/optee-rng.c Signed-off-by: Patrick Delaunay <patrick.delaunay@foss.st.com> --- MAINTAINERS | 1 + drivers/rng/Kconfig | 8 +++ drivers/rng/Makefile | 1 + drivers/rng/optee_rng.c | 156 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++ 4 files changed, 166 insertions(+) create mode 100644 drivers/rng/optee_rng.c
